Does the Enclave Have a Five-Seater Version?

The Enclave does not have a five-seater version. It is classified as a mid-to-large-sized SUV with the following dimensions: length 4981mm, width 1953mm, height 1727mm, and a wheelbase of 2863mm. It has a fuel tank capacity of 73 liters and a trunk capacity ranging from 222 to 1970 liters. The tire specification is 235/65R18. The Enclave is equipped with a 2.0T turbocharged engine, delivering a maximum power of 174kW at 5000rpm and a maximum torque of 350Nm between 1500 to 4000rpm. It is paired with a 9-speed automatic transmission.

How to Replace the Battery in a Golf 7 Key?

Steps to replace the battery in a Golf 7 key: 1. Remove the mechanical key from the car remote key; 2. Insert a flat-head screwdriver into the mechanical keyhole of the car remote key and rotate to unlock the key clasp; 3. Open the car remote key cover; 4. Remove the old battery from the remote key and install a new key battery; 5. Press and close the car remote key cover firmly. How to Reset the Maintenance Light on a Hyundai Elantra?

Steps to reset the maintenance light on a Hyundai Elantra: First, turn the Elantra's power to ON mode; then, the dashboard will display the maintenance message for a few seconds; press and hold the RESET button for more than 5 seconds to activate the reset mode, and finally, press the RESET button for more than 1 second to reset the maintenance light. How to Remove the Spark Plugs on a Hyundai Elantra?

To remove the spark plugs on a Hyundai Elantra, follow these steps: 1. Ensure the engine is cool and prepare the necessary tools, including a wrench, socket, and adapter. 2. Disconnect the ignition coil and remove it. In all gasoline-powered vehicles, the spark plugs are located beneath the ignition coils, with a nearby power connector. 3. Unscrew the spark plugs using an appropriate socket, being careful to avoid letting dust enter the combustion chamber. Can You Continue Driving with a Red-Hot Turbocharger?

You should not continue driving if the turbocharger is red-hot. If the turbocharger has turned red, you can let the engine idle for a while to allow the turbo to cool down. During this time, you can open the engine hood to help the turbo dissipate heat more quickly. Below are some relevant details: 1. Turbocharger: A turbocharger consists of two parts: a compression turbine and an exhaust turbine. The working principle of a turbocharged engine is quite simple. When the engine reaches a certain RPM, the exhaust gases will have enough energy to spin the exhaust turbine, which in turn spins the compression turbine. This allows the compression turbine to compress air and force it into the cylinders. 2. Precautions: After driving a turbocharged car at high speeds or over long distances, you should avoid turning off the engine immediately. Instead, let the engine idle for a few minutes to help the turbo cool down.

How often should a car be started if left unused for a long time?

It is recommended to start the vehicle at least every fifteen days, letting it run for over half an hour, and preferably moving the car or driving a short distance. Additional details are as follows: 1. Battery issues: The most common problem when a vehicle is left unused for a long time is the battery. After parking and locking the vehicle, although most electrical components enter a dormant state, certain parts of the vehicle still require power, such as the anti-theft system. Therefore, a small dormant current is generated, which, over time, can lead to a low battery charge, making it difficult to start the engine. To prevent this, it is necessary to periodically start the engine to recharge the battery. 2. Tire issues: Prolonged parking can cause the tires to bear weight at the same spot continuously, potentially leading to deformation over time. This can result in vibrations when driving. Hence, it is advisable to move the vehicle periodically to distribute the weight more evenly across the tires.

Where is the Lincoln MKC horn located?

Lincoln MKC horn is located inside the bumper of the front wheels, and the position to press the horn is in the center of the steering wheel. The horn is the audio signal device of the car. During the driving process, the driver can issue necessary audio signals according to needs and regulations to warn pedestrians and attract the attention of other vehicles, ensuring traffic safety. It is also used to urge movement and transmit signals. The following is the connection method of the car horn relay: 1. 30 (red) is connected to the positive pole of the battery. 2. 85 is connected to one of the original car horn wires. 3. 87 is divided into two wires and connected to one side of each of the two horns. 4. 86 and the remaining two horn wires are connected to one of the original car horn wires (it is worth mentioning that if the horn does not sound, you can swap 86 and 85).
